Diane Student and I had a fun, wide-ranging conversation about how music production and podcasting have evolved—and what it takes now to actually keep an audience engaged. We talked about how video is changing the podcast world fast, and how it’s becoming part of the whole package instead of an optional add-on. From there we went down some fascinating rabbit holes: the cultural pull of the 27 Club, why certain stories stick, and how places like burial grounds and “haunted” locations carry a weird kind of weight. We also got into the paranormal world—not just the spooky side, but the business side too, and how people build real content and experiences around it.
